Thomas Prendergast Obituary

Thomas A. Prendergast

 

Age 89, of Pittsburgh, passed away peacefully on July 22, 2021. Forever a bachelor, Tom is survived by one sister, Margaret Ann Weis, and a multitude of nieces and nephews, and grands. He was the son of Irish immigrants, Philip and Margaret Coyne Prendergast and was preceded in death by his brothers and sisters, Mary Burgoon, Jack Prendergast, Teresa Weis and Charles "Bud" Prendergast, as well as his dear friend Audrey Houck. Tom was well loved by everyone who knew him, he was charming and handsome, generous and funny. He was proud of his Irish heritage and enjoyed visiting his cousins in Galway and Mayo. Tom grew up in Oakland and attended St. Agnes School and Central Catholic High School before serving in the U.S. Army during the Korean Conflict. His first job was selling newspapers in Forbes Field so he could get in for free. He continued his "ballyard career" by working at the Pittsburgh stadiums for games and events as a second job for many years. He loved to walk and likely walked a mile a day until recently. "Our Tom" will be dearly missed. Tom's family extends special thanks to the caregivers, kitchens and staff of New Hope Personal Care, Arden Courts of North Hills and Hope Hospice. Friends will be received at John A. Freyvogel Sons, Inc. (freyvogelfuneralhome.com) 4900 Centre Avenue at Devonshire Street on Tuesday from 8:30a.m. to 9:30a.m. followed by a Mass of Christian Burial in St. Paul Cathedral at 10a.m.
